Output 8f21e2ff3acffe935e1ad89b4b2c3c0bcdc31b4c813caa5ddd655e2800202551:9

value
673300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d4b465f30fb5c4ffaa5b68e511b1281529176fc OP_EQUALVERIFY OP_CHECKSIG
address
1Dt6TEsTiF1ShF7rag1Pfj95xzhBH8zPn1
transaction
8f21e2ff3acffe935e1ad89b4b2c3c0bcdc31b4c813caa5ddd655e2800202551
confirmations
266865
spent
true